The “5 no, 3 clean” campaign: Supporting women to escape poverty sustainably

With the criterion of "No poverty", the Vietnam Women's Union has regularly maintained activities to support women in poverty reduction and economic development, associated with new rural criteria on income, poor households, employed workers, production organization and rural economic development.

The campaign "Building a family of 5 no, 3 clean" was launched by the Vietnam Women's Union in 2010, and has now really gone into depth and become a core and consistent campaign of the Union at all levels. After nearly 15 years of implementation, the campaign has achieved many outstanding results, improving the material and spiritual life of women, while clearly affirming the role, position and practical contribution of the Union in the cause of economic and social development of the country.

In particular, communication work has been strongly innovated, flexibly combining propaganda forms, especially the application of digital technology and social networks to increase the spread, contributing to a clear change in awareness, arousing the sense of responsibility and active participation of members and women. With specific forms such as: Saving to buy health insurance, building hygienic toilets, sorting waste at source, planting trees, renovating fields, donating land to open roads, irrigation...

Over the past 15 years, women's union members nationwide have donated over 5.6 million square meters of land, contributed money and working days to build new rural areas; more than 90% of union members have had access to information on the criteria of "Family of 5 no's, 3 clean's" and "Family of 5 yes's, 3 clean's"; organized over 181,000 training classes, seminars, and specialized communication on gender equality, domestic violence prevention, environmental protection, entrepreneurship, vocational training, family life education , etc.

During the term, the Association at all levels helped 210,250 households escape poverty.

In particular, with the criterion of "No poverty", the associations regularly maintain activities to support women in poverty reduction and economic development, associated with the new rural criteria of income, poor households, employed workers, production organization and rural economic development. Many key programs have been effectively implemented: Project "Supporting women to start a business in the period 2017-2025", Project "Supporting cooperatives managed by women, creating jobs for female workers until 2030" and the One Commune One Product (OCOP) Program, the National Target Program for Sustainable Poverty Reduction. Activities to support women in accessing credit, especially policy credit and microcredit, have been promoted.

With a proactive spirit and creative approach, the Vietnam Women's Union is the socio-political organization with the highest outstanding policy credit balance among the four socio-political organizations, with over 180 trillion VND lending to over 2.8 million households; The entrusted capital of the Social Policy Bank alone reached 148 trillion VND (accounting for nearly 38% of the total entrusted debt balance nationwide). Along with that, more than 71,000 savings and loan groups were maintained, mobilizing over 39 billion VND to support millions of women in economic development, participating in health insurance and implementing social security. Many creative and practical models have been deployed and replicated by the Women's Union at all levels such as: "Women's group of 3 savings: electricity, water, gas", "Turning waste into money", "Pot of love porridge", "Coat of love", "Raising piggy banks to save money and participate in social insurance"... contributing to improving living standards and spreading the spirit of mutual love in the community.

The targets for helping women escape poverty and near-poverty; supporting capacity building for women who are business owners, cooperative managers, business owners and supporting the establishment of cooperatives all exceeded the targets of the term. During the term, the Union at all levels helped 210,250 households escape poverty, making an important contribution to sustainable poverty reduction and social security; mobilizing and supporting the establishment of 666 new cooperatives and 838 cooperative groups, creating jobs for nearly 3,000 female workers; supporting more than 57,000 women to start businesses, attracting more than 41,568 ideas, awarding prizes to 187 outstanding ideas. More than 239,000 women who are business owners, cooperative managers, and business households received training to improve their capacity. In addition, the Union at all levels has provided career counseling and job introductions to 519,000 female workers, of whom 490,000 have stable jobs.

In addition, supporting the establishment of 666 new cooperatives and 838 cooperative groups, creating jobs for nearly 3,000 female workers.

The movement "For the poor - No one left behind" was strongly spread: the Union at all levels mobilized members and women to build and repair 13,578 charity houses; mobilized more than 193 billion VND to support "Day for the poor"; 285.2 billion VND to support people affected by natural disasters, calamities, storms and floods; supported money and gifts worth 306.65 billion VND to help policy families, Vietnamese Heroic Mothers, and families of war invalids and martyrs.

Thereby, it can be seen that, after nearly 15 years of implementation, the Campaign "Building a family of 5 no, 3 clean" not only contributes to building a new rural appearance, spreading good humanistic values, but also becomes a practical support to help hundreds of thousands of women escape poverty and stabilize their lives. The loving homes built, economic models led by women initiated, hundreds of thousands of new jobs opened... have vividly demonstrated the persistent companionship of the Vietnam Women's Union. This is a bold mark affirming the role and position of women in socio-economic development, at the same time arousing the belief, will and aspiration to rise up to become rich legitimately of Vietnamese women in the new era./.
